Originally an Ermine White car with a White top and Medium Blue
interior, this Chevy now wears a lustrous coat of red paint in high
driver quality condition, contrasted by a crisp white top and
accompanied by a fresh red interior. Up front, you'll find a bright
horizontal grille with dual side-by-side round headlights and a
colorful Chevy badge at the center with a gleaming chrome bumper
beneath. Brightwork continues with window trim, wiper arms, wheel
lip molding, dual side mirrors, antenna, and door handles. Both
sides of the car wear "350 cross-flags" fender badges and "Malibu
Chevelle" rear quarter badges - all in excellent condition. The
manually operated white convertible top is free of any stains or
tears, and it features a clear plastic rear window in good
condition. A custom-made red vinyl boot cover comes with the car to
cover the top when it's in the down position, and it looks
fantastic. The side view is further enhanced by a set of 5-spoke
Ridler wheels all wrapped in white-letter BF Goodrich tires, a
perfect choice for this ride. Around back is brighter trim that
surrounds the taillights and lower decklid with "CHEVROLET"
lettering, another chrome bumper, a hidden gas fill behind the
license plate, and dual chrome elliptical exhaust tips.
Lift the big red hood to reveal a clean and organized engine bay
that you'd be proud to show off at any car show. Originally a 327ci
car, this Malibu now boasts a fresh orange GM Crate 350ci V-8 with
only 452 miles on it since it was installed in 2022. The engine is
topped off with a Kelley Contender intake manifold, an Edelbrock
AVS2 4-barrel carburetor, chrome valve covers emblazoned with
bowtie logos and "Chevrolet", and a chrome Chevrolet air cleaner
with 350 TurboFire 300hp decals. The excitement doesn't end there,
though. Other highlights include a chrome alternator, chrome timing
cover, an electric choke, a chrome radiator overflow cannister,
power steering, a new water pump, a new starter, and black front
show panels with an engraved bowtie logo and '65 Malibu. The V-8 is
mated up to a 2-speed Powerglide transmission that sends power to
the pavement via a 10-bolt rear axle. Exhaust flows through
Headmann headers, new mufflers, and new pipes to exit the rear with
a subtle rumble that's sure to put a smile on your face. Stopping
power comes courtesy of power front discs and rear drums with a new
master cylinder.
When you open the driver's door, courtesy lights come on to
illuminate a luxurious red interior with some custom touches added
to the original flair. The door panels look OEM correct with red
vinyl and bright trim. The seats are as comfortable as they are
attractive - dressed in flawless red vinyl, with buckets up front
and a bench in the rear. The front seats have chrome trim on the
outside edge that adds to the classy look. Between the front
buckets is a custom center console that's covered in red vinyl and
offers an armrest/storage box, 2 cupholders, 2 speakers, and a
Hurst pistol-grip quarter-stick shifter. Where the console rises to
meet the dash, there are a trio of under-dash mounted Autogage
gauges with chrome surround (water, volt, oil). Ahead of the driver
is an aftermarket 3-spoke wood-ringed steering wheel on a new tilt
column. Behind the wheel is a slick red painted dash with a bright
instrument and gauge bezel. Within the bezel are controls for the
lights and wipers, a 120mph speedometer, an analog clock (inop), a
fuel gauge, warning lights for gen/temp/oil, and an AM/FM
Retrosound-style radio to play your favorite cruisin' tunes. Below
the bezel are slider controls for the heat and fan. Ahead of the
passenger is an empty glovebox with bright trim on the door.
Underfoot is high-quality hook & loop carpet kept nice with red and
black, rubber & carpet, logo floor mats. Back in the trunk is a
vinyl mat, a car cover, the aforementioned red boot cover, the
original steering wheel (in good condition), and a folder full of
receipts for work done since 2021.
